The Importance of Introducing Python Programming in Middle School Education

In today’s digital age, technology is advancing at an unprecedented pace, transforming various industries and reshaping the way we live and work. As such, equipping students with essential digital skills, particularly programming, has become a paramount concern for educators worldwide. Among the myriad of programming languages, Python stands out as an ideal choice for introducing coding concepts to middle school students. This article discusses the importance of incorporating Python programming into middle school education.

Firstly, Python’s syntax is straightforward and easy to learn, making it an excellent starting point for beginners. Its readability and simplicity allow students to grasp fundamental programming concepts without being overwhelmed by complex syntax. This accessibility fosters a positive learning environment where students can quickly build confidence in their coding abilities, setting a solid foundation for future learning in more advanced programming languages.

Secondly, Python’s versatility makes it a valuable tool for teaching a wide range of computing concepts. From basic algorithms and data structures to web development, machine learning, and data analysis, Python offers ample opportunities for students to explore various domains within computer science. This versatility not only broadens students’ understanding of programming but also enables them to identify their interests and potentially specialize in a specific area.

Moreover, integrating Python programming into the middle school curriculum encourages problem-solving and critical thinking skills. Programming requires students to break down complex problems into smaller, manageable tasks, fostering logical reasoning and analytical thinking. As students engage in hands-on coding activities, they learn to approach challenges systematically, experiment with solutions, and persevere through difficulties, all of which are crucial skills for success in any field.

Furthermore, introducing Python programming at an early age promotes creativity and innovation. By learning to code, students can transform their ideas into reality, creating games, applications, or even tools that address real-world problems. This process of creation nurtures a mindset of innovation, encouraging students to think outside the box and develop unique solutions.

Lastly, in today’s job market, proficiency in programming is a highly sought-after skill. By offering Python programming courses in middle school, educators are preparing students for future career opportunities in technology and other sectors. Even for students who do not pursue a career in computer science, understanding programming can enhance their employability and adaptability in a tech-driven world.

In conclusion, introducing Python programming in middle school education is a strategic move that can significantly benefit students. It provides a gateway to the vast field of computer science, nurtures essential skills for the 21st century, and sets a strong foundation for lifelong learning and career success. As educators continue to adapt to the evolving needs of the digital age, embracing Python programming as part of the curriculum is a step towards ensuring that students are well-prepared for the challenges and opportunities of the future.
